Headline

Germantown 5-Miler & Family Fun Run/Walk
By Danny Talmage
January 26, 2007
Germantown, MD
For the Washington Running Report

The Mid-Atlantic Federal Credit Union Germantown 5-Miler returns to upper Montgomery County!

This family-friendly event, presented by Seneca Creek Community Church and benefiting the Germantown Boys and Girls Club and Shady Grove Adventist Hospital, will take place on Saturday, May 19th at the Seneca Meadows Corporate Center in Germantown, MD. But be forewarned--this is not just your average 5 mile race! A 1K kids run will kick off the event at 8:10 am. followed by the 5 mile ChampionChip timed race at 8:30 am. And last but not least, a 2-mile run fun allowing strollers and dogs will begin at 8:40 am.

Beneficiaries. This year the race proceeds will go to support two well-deserving local charities, namely the Germantown Boys & Girls Club and the Shady Grove Adventist Emergency Center.

The mission of the Germantown Boys & Girls Club is to help boys and girls of all backgrounds, with an emphasis on at- risk youth, to build confidence, develop character, and acquire the skills needed to become productive, civic-minded, responsible adults. Today children come from families in which both parents work. In fact, this situation seems to define the "traditional" family these days. Elementary students today lack the community support required to deal with academics, extracurricular activities, and social challenges. The Germantown Boys & Girls Club seeks to provide youth with a positive and safe place in which their development is sought. Shady Grove Adventist Emergency Center at Germantown, the first freestanding emergency department in Montgomery County, has treated thousands of patients since its opening in July 2006. Thanks to streamlined procedures, patients with medical emergencies can now have faster access to top of the line care. The new design will now move patients quickly from registration directly to one of the 21 patient rooms where a nurse can begin collecting information and providing care. Each room is set up with the state of the art technology needed for the patient, including special monitoring and imaging equipment. By the time tests are completed, the physician can be assessing the patient. The Center is open 24/7 to treat accidents, walk-ins, and those who arrive by ambulance. Located next door, for our patients' convenience, Shady Grove Radiology provides a full-service medical imaging facility. Shady Grove Adventist Hospital is working hard to bring the best patient care to the community.
